The Product Support Engineer will play a key role in supporting the development and enhancement of industrial technology solutions through New Product Introduction (NPI) and Continuous Product Improvement (CPI) initiatives. This position involves technical validation, defect analysis, customer support, and cross-functional collaboration to ensure high product quality and performance. Key Responsibilities
New Product Introduction (NPI) — Develop and maintain technical documentation for new products. New Product Introduction (NPI) — Validate form, fit, and function of newly developed systems and components. New Product Introduction (NPI) — Collaborate with engineering and testing teams to ensure readiness for deployment. New Product Introduction (NPI) — Investigate and analyze defects in existing production systems. New Product Introduction (NPI) — Conduct root cause analysis and recommend corrective actions. New Product Introduction (NPI) — Integrate customer feedback into product enhancement strategies. Customer & Field Support — Provide advanced technical support to internal and external stakeholders. Customer & Field Support — Triage escalations and assist in restoring production systems. Customer & Field Support — Occasionally visit field sites for validation and troubleshooting (PPE provided). Project Coordination — Manage timelines and deliverables for NPI/CPI projects. Project Coordination — Work closely with global teams to ensure alignment and execution. Required Skills
Technical Skills Experience supporting technology in industrial or production environments. Familiarity with TCP/IP networking. Familiarity with Microsoft client/server platforms. Reading and interpreting schematics. Strong data gathering and analysis capabilities. Soft Skills Customer focus and service excellence. Effective communication and relationship management.
